A Korean celadon incised ‘lotus’ bottle vase, Goryeo dynasty, 12-13th century

A Korean celadon incised ‘lotus’ bottle vase, Goryeo dynasty, 12-13th century

Lot 2986. A Korean celadon incised ‘lotus’ bottle vase, Goryeo dynasty, 12-13th century; 13 3/4 in. (35 cm.) high. Estimate HKD 280,000 - HKD 350,000Price realised HKD 350,000. © Christie's Images Ltd 2017

The vase is incised in thin lines on the body with three separate lotus sprays, below a band of ruyi-heads around the shoulder and above overlapping lotus petals around the foot, covered overall with a finely crackled greyish-green glaze fired to a golden-russet colour towards the mouth, the base with spur marks; Japanese wood box.

Christie's. Important Chinese Ceramics and Works of Art, 29 November 2017, Hong Kong
